Revised Problem Statement
After weighing all the customer needs, the desired
electric toothbrush model needs to be above all portable,
then versatile, then user friendly, and lastly reliable.
These needs reflect the customer’s desire for a travel
electric toothbrush, not an advanced home toothbrush.

Technological Description
• Power supply through USB cable
• 4 flat rechargeable batteries insure a long life between charges
Technical Description
Power transfer via rotating drive shaft from motor
Transferred through ball joint with a universal joint
Rotation is transferred 90 degrees with spider gears
A pin from the rear and outer edge of the gear hits lobes on the brush head creating brush motion
